基本释义
在数据处理与分析的日常工作中,我们常常会遇到需要从一组数据中识别出最优项的场景。例如,在销售业绩表里找出月度冠军,或在体育比赛积分中确定优胜队伍。针对用户提出的“excel如何弄冠军”这一问题,其核心是探讨如何利用电子表格软件的功能,高效且准确地从数据集合中筛选、标识或计算出排名第一的条目。这里的“弄冠军”是一个形象化的口语表达,实质是指通过一系列操作步骤,达成在数据中凸显“冠军”即最高值或最优记录的目标。 核心概念解析 要理解如何“弄冠军”,首先需明确几个关键概念。数据区域指的是包含所有待比较数值的单元格范围;比较基准则是判断冠军的依据,如数值最大、分数最高或时间最短;结果呈现则关乎冠军信息以何种形式展示,是直接标记、单独提取还是动态关联。 通用方法框架 实现目标通常遵循一个清晰的流程。第一步是数据准备,确保相关数据完整、格式统一且无异常值干扰。第二步是确定评选规则,即明确依据哪个字段或指标来决出冠军。第三步是应用工具,利用软件内置的函数或功能执行查找与判断。最后一步是输出结果,将找到的冠军信息以清晰可视的方式呈现在表格中。 常见应用场景 此操作在实际中应用广泛。在商业分析中,可用于快速定位销售额最高的产品或业绩最佳的员工。在教育管理里,能迅速找出单科或总分第一的学生。在活动策划时,可以帮助统计投票数最多的选项。掌握这一技能,能显著提升从海量数据中捕捉关键信息的效率,使数据分析工作更加聚焦和有力。 方法价值总结 总而言之,“弄冠军”的操作远不止于找到一个最大值。它体现了从被动记录数据到主动挖掘数据价值的思维转变。通过灵活运用相关功能,我们不仅能得到“谁是冠军”这个简单答案,还能进一步分析冠军与平均水平之间的差距,或追踪冠军数据的历史变化趋势,从而为决策提供更深入的洞察。这是将静态表格转化为动态分析工具的重要一环。
详细释义
当我们需要在纷繁复杂的数据列表中快速锁定那个最突出的佼佼者时,“如何弄冠军”就成为了一个非常实际的需求。这不仅仅是找到最大的数字那么简单,它涉及到数据准备、逻辑判断、工具选用和结果优化等一系列系统性操作。下面,我们将从多个维度深入剖析在电子表格中实现这一目标的具体路径与技巧。 基础定位:使用核心函数直接查找 对于初学者而言,最直接的方法是借助软件内置的统计函数。例如,`MAX`函数可以迅速返回指定区域中的最大值。假设我们有一列B2到B100的销售数据,在空白单元格输入`=MAX(B2:B100)`,就能立刻得到销售额冠军的具体数值。然而,仅仅知道冠军的数值往往不够,我们更想知道这个数值对应的是哪个销售员或哪款产品。这时,就需要`INDEX`与`MATCH`函数组合出场。首先用`MATCH`函数定位冠军数值在数据列中的精确位置,语法如`=MATCH(MAX(B2:B100), B2:B100, 0)`,它会返回一个代表行号的数字。然后,用`INDEX`函数根据这个行号,从旁边的姓名列(假设在A列)中提取出对应的信息,完整公式为`=INDEX(A2:A100, MATCH(MAX(B2:B100), B2:B100, 0))`。如此一来,冠军的归属便一目了然。 动态追踪:结合条件格式突出显示 为了让冠军在表格中自动地、醒目地跳出来,我们可以运用条件格式这一可视化利器。选中需要监控的数据区域,新建一条格式规则,选择“使用公式确定要设置格式的单元格”。在公式框中输入类似`=B2=MAX($B$2:$B$100)`的表达式(注意根据实际数据调整单元格引用和区域范围)。这个公式的含义是,判断当前单元格的值是否等于整个区域的最大值。接着,为符合此条件的单元格设置一个鲜明的格式,比如亮红色的填充、加粗的字体或特殊的边框。点击确定后,你会发现,无论数据如何更新变化,当前数据区域中的最高值总会以你设定的方式高亮显示,实现了冠军的实时动态追踪,非常适合用于仪表盘或经常变动的数据看板。 进阶分析:构建简易排名系统 有时,我们的需求不只是找出冠军,还想了解所有参与者的名次排序。这时可以利用`RANK`函数或其升级版`RANK.EQ`函数来构建一个完整的排名列。在数据表旁边新增一列,命名为“排名”,然后在第一个单元格输入公式`=RANK.EQ(B2, $B$2:$B$100, 0)`,其中第三个参数为0表示降序排列(数值越大排名越靠前)。将此公式向下填充,每个数据对应的名次就自动计算出来了。排名为1的,自然就是冠军。这种方法的好处在于,它能提供更全面的竞争态势,不仅看到榜首,还能清晰看到亚军、季军以及各梯队分布,便于进行更深入的对比分析。 复杂场景:处理多条件与并列情况 现实情况往往更为复杂。例如,我们需要找出“第二事业部”中“产品A”的销售额冠军,这就涉及多个筛选条件。传统的`MAX`函数无法直接处理,需要借助数组公式或更强大的`MAXIFS`函数(请注意软件版本支持)。`MAXIFS`函数允许我们设置多个条件,其基本语法为`=MAXIFS(求值区域, 条件区域1, 条件1, 条件区域2, 条件2, ...)`。它能精准地在满足所有条件的子集中找到最大值。另一个棘手的问题是出现并列冠军,即多个数据同时达到最高值。上述的`INDEX-MATCH`组合默认只返回第一个匹配项。如果需要列出所有并列冠军,可以考虑使用`FILTER`函数(较新版本支持)或通过复杂的数组公式进行文本拼接,这需要更高级的技巧。 交互展示:创建冠军查询工具 为了提升报告的交互性和友好度,我们可以设计一个简易的冠军查询界面。在一个单独的 sheet 或区域,设置下拉菜单(数据验证功能),让用户可以选择不同的数据类别或时间段。然后,使用`INDIRECT`函数动态引用用户选择所对应的数据区域,再结合前述的`INDEX-MATCH`或`MAXIFS`函数,将计算出的冠军姓名和数值显示在指定的单元格中。这样,使用者无需接触原始数据,只需通过下拉菜单选择,就能即时查看不同维度下的冠军信息,极大地提升了数据报告的可用性和专业性。 实践要点与常见误区 在实践过程中,有几个要点需要特别注意。首先是数据的清洁性,确保参与比较的数据是规范的数值格式,避免文本型数字或空单元格影响函数计算。其次是引用方式的正确使用,在公式中灵活运用绝对引用(如$B$2:$B$100)和相对引用,确保公式在填充或复制时能正确指向目标区域。一个常见的误区是忽略数据的更新范围,当新增数据行时,务必记得调整函数中引用的区域范围,否则新数据可能不会被纳入冠军评选。对于需要频繁更新的表格,建议将数据区域转换为“表格”对象,这样公式引用时会自动扩展,一劳永逸。 综上所述,在电子表格中“弄冠军”是一门融合了函数应用、格式设置与数据思维的综合技艺。从简单的最大值查找,到复杂的多条件动态排名,每一种方法都服务于不同的场景与深度需求。掌握这些方法,就如同为你的数据分析装备上了一双敏锐的眼睛,能够瞬间捕捉到数据海洋中最闪亮的那颗星,从而让数据真正开口说话,驱动更明智的决策。